CourseDetails
โข Disaster Response Fundamentals: Understanding disaster response principles, types of disasters, and the role of professionals in disaster response.
โข Disaster Risk Reduction (DRR): Assessing and managing risks associated with disasters, DRR strategies, and integrating DRR into disaster response programs.
โข Psychosocial Support in Disaster Response: Recognizing and addressing psychosocial needs of disaster-affected populations, and providing appropriate support interventions.
โข Disaster Logistics and Supply Chain Management: Managing disaster logistics, coordinating supply chains, and ensuring effective resource allocation.
โข Disaster Communication and Coordination: Effective communication strategies and coordination mechanisms for successful disaster response.
โข Disaster Response Planning and Management: Developing comprehensive disaster response plans, managing disaster response operations, and evaluating disaster response performance.
โข Migration and Displacement in Disasters: Understanding the dynamics of migration and displacement in disasters, and the role of disaster response professionals in supporting displaced populations.
โข Disaster Law and Policy: Exploring legal frameworks and policies governing disaster response, and the ethical considerations for disaster response professionals.
โข Climate Change and Disaster Response: Understanding the impact of climate change on disasters, and adapting disaster response strategies to address climate-related risks.
